How do I choose the right paint colors for a Tudorbethan-style bedroom?

Choosing the right paint colors for a Tudorbethan-style bedroom involves considering the historical context and design elements typically found in this architectural style. To create an authentic and cohesive look, follow these steps:

1. Research Tudorbethan-style: Study the features and characteristics of Tudorbethan architecture and interior design. This style often incorporates dark, rich colors with an emphasis on natural materials and textures.

2. Pick a starting point: Identify a key element in the room that will serve as a starting point when selecting paint colors. This could be a prominent piece of furniture, an artwork, or an architectural element like a fireplace or a wooden beam.

3. Neutral walls: Begin with a neutral base color for the walls. Opt for warm, earthy shades like beige, cream, or light brown to create a cozy atmosphere in line with Tudorbethan style.

4. Accent wall: Consider creating an accent wall. Select a darker, bolder color that complements the neutral walls, such as deep burgundy, forest green, navy blue, or rich gold. The accent wall can be applied behind the bed, fireplace, or another focal point.

5. Woodwork and trim: Highlight the architectural details and woodwork by painting them in a contrasting color. Typically, Tudorbethan interiors feature dark-stained or painted wood, so deep shades like espresso, black, or dark brown work well.

6. Ceiling and moldings: Emphasize the intricate ceiling and moldings by painting them in a lighter color to create contrast and bring attention to these details. Opt for off-white, cream, or a pale shade that complements the wall color.

7. Color accents: Add color accents through accessories, textiles, or small furniture pieces. Explore tones like russet, jewel tones, or vibrant medieval colors like deep red, emerald green, royal blue, or golden yellow for cushions, curtains, and rugs.

8. Test samples: Before committing to a color scheme, test paint samples on the walls and observe them under different lighting conditions. This will help you evaluate how the colors appear in your specific bedroom and ensure they work together harmoniously.

Remember, the key is to capture the essence of Tudorbethan style with a combination of warm, rich, and contrasting colors that enhance the overall ambiance of the bedroom.
